Palak Paneer (Spinach and Cheese Curry)
Report
Vegetarian palak paneer curry has a creamy spinach gravy and fried seasoned paneer cheese cubes that’s soft inside and crispy outside.

Ingredients
Cheese
- 1/2 lb paneer cheese cubed (See Note 1)
- 1/2 tsp ground turmeric
- 1/2 tsp chili powder
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 2 tbsp canola oil
Spinach
- 1 lb fresh baby spinach
- 1 cup water
- 1 tsp cumin seeds
- 1 tsp ground turmeric
- 1 tsp red chili powder
- 3 cloves garlic finely chopped
- 3 tbsp PLAIN yogurt I like Greek, thicker

Instructions
- Cut the paneer into bite size cubes and pierce with a fork (optional) transfer to bowl. Add the turmeric, chili powder and salt, tossing to coat well. Set aside to marinate and prep spinach.
- In a large saucepan add the water and top with spinach. Bring water to a boil, cover and simmer 2 minutes to steam spinach. Remove lid and cook until the water has evaporated. Allow the spinach to cool, then puree to a thick paste in a food processor. Set aside.
- In a large skillet over a medium–high heat pan fry the paneer in the oil until nicely browned on edges, turning occasionally. Set aside.
- In same skillet with remaining oil over a medium–high heat temper the cumin seeds until they sizzle, 30 seconds. Then add the turmeric, chili powder and the garlic. Fry until garlic turns a light golden brown.
- Add the blended spinach to the pan and stir in the yogurt. Stir in the fried paneer and heat through. Season with salt and serve immediately. Sometimes I like to serve with lemon wedges to squeeze over, optional.
Notes
- You could also pierce the cubed paneer all over with a fork to assist the seasoning to penetrate the cheese.
